View An Ode to Nature Gallery“An Ode to Nature” by Francis Evangelista, on view at Galerie Joaquin Podium
Exhibit run: March 2 - 11, 2023Portrayals of the environment are considered essential in figurative abstraction, as the concept’s universality can extend to leaps and bounds of artistic expression. Humans are intrinsically connected to nature and its evolution – our scientific and philosophical parallel to its elements both effectively create change, progress, and development. Francis Evangelista is an adaptor and a creator that is driven by this notion, illustrating an interpretation of nature that reflects and dedicates his relationship to the greenery around him.
“An Ode to Nature”, the artist’s first solo exhibition with Galerie Joaquin, is a vibrant and spirited opus of work inspired and dedicated to the fascinating nuances of trees. Evangelista’s acquired artistic skill further takes certain features from his chosen subject and illustrates an oeuvre of recurring shapes, patterns, colors, and forms – imitating, at the same time, creating a kind of nature that forms exciting interpretations anew.
The works are described as a fascinating juxtaposition of modern, contemporary, traditional, and abstract art with remarkable attention to lines and color. In particular, his oeuvre consists of figurative yet abstract interpretations of nature – persistent shapes and colors illustrated to form forest scapes of towering heights that contain varying colors and textured lines. Each colored line is intricately designed: splashed, rugged yet definite forms are embellished to bring out texture, similar to fabric textiles.
With these in mind, the exhibition hopes to reinforce and celebrate the importance of nature and its implicit relation to the human spirit.
Francis G. Evangelista is a self-taught artist hailing from Rizal. From his formative years, the artist gained a passionate interest in the arts primarily influenced by his grandfather, who was an arc designer for the traditional Santa Cruzan. Strengthening his passion, he started painting in high school and graduated from the University of Rizal System, with his works inspired by the Honorable National Artist Fernando Amorsolo. It was during this time that Francis discovered the valuable impact of adept artistry in becoming a memorable artist.
Evangelista has kept a promising artistic career, continuing to shape and hone his craft by becoming a professional art teacher and conducting exclusive lessons for selected students. He’s a member of the Artipolo Group Inc. based in Antipolo, Rizal, and has actively participated in notable art competitions, murals, and commissioned works. He’s also one of Galerie Joaquin’s rising artists.
